2921 читали · 5 лет назад
Аппроксимация функций в Matlab
Matlab имеет большой набор возможностей для интерполяции и аппроксимации функций. Здесь мы рассмотрим наиболее простые и удобные средства, позволяющие работать в графическом окне. Решение задач интерполяции и аппроксимации функций и табличных данных с использованием графического окна сопровождается их визуализацией. Технология аппроксимации заключается в построении узловых точек функции (или табличных данных) и в построении функции аппроксимации или интерполяции. Для простых видов аппроксимации желательно нанесение на график формулы, полученной для аппроксимации...
141 читали · 3 года назад
Штриховка области в MATLAB
В MATLAB для закрашивания области под кривой Y существует функция area(X,Y). Однако при построении графиков иногда требуется заштриховать (а не закрасить) область прямыми линиями, для чего в MATLAB нет встроенного инструмента. Для решения этой проблемы мной была написана функция plotShady(x1,y1,x2,y2,k0,r,color,lineW), которая покрывает область параллельными линиями между двумя кривыми: первая кривая - x1 и y1, вторая кривая - x2 и y2. Можно задавать их наклон (k0), толщину (lineW), цвет (color) и расстояние (r) между ними...